90 days within any 180-day period. Transfers allowed. Invitation letter in the case of a private visit, i.e. proof of accommodation or proof of itinerary from the travel agency in the case of a tourist visit. Even if you intend NOT to use a travel agency the embassy will insist on an invitation letter. National visa may be substituted by a valid visa OR residence permit issued by any EU member state, Schengen Area member state, UK, or US, for a period not exceeding 90 days in a 180-day period and within the validity of the visa or residence permit.

Required documents
  • Valid passport (at least 6 months validity; scan of bio-data page required)
  • Passport-size photograph (JPG/JPEG format for online upload)
  • Credit/debit card for e-Visa fee payment (online application)
  • Return / onward flight booking details
  • Hotel / accommodation booking details
  • Bank statement or proof of sufficient funds
  • Email address for e-Visa delivery
